A procedure is described for obtaining sufficient field loss data for statistical analysis. Some sources of loss are identified and methods of preparing wilted forage for ensiling compared. Use of a combination mow‐condition‐windrow machine resulted in less loss than the conventional mow‐condition‐wilt‐rake method. Losses caused by leaching and slow drying appeared minor compared to physical losses from raking.
